**2. Cross-Platform Compatibility
Plesk offers extensive compatibility with multiple operating systems and server environments.
Advantages:
- Windows and Linux Support: Plesk supports both Windows and Linux platforms, providing flexibility in choosing your hosting environment.
- Integration with Web Servers: It seamlessly integrates with popular web servers like Apache and Nginx.
Comparison:
- Unlike cPanel, which is primarily Linux-focused, Plesk's cross-platform capabilities make it a versatile choice for various server configurations.

**8. Developer-Friendly Environment
Plesk provides a rich environment for developers, offering support for multiple programming languages and frameworks.
Advantages:
- Multi-Language Support: Supports PHP, Python, Ruby, Node.js, and more.
- Development Tools: Features like Git integration and Docker support make it easier for developers to deploy and manage applications.
Comparison:
- Compared to other platforms like cPanel, Plesk offers more comprehensive tools and support for modern development practices.
